Total Student Population Comparison

The total student population of selected colleges is 5,187 with 2,189 female students and 2,998 male students. This enrollment statistics is based on the latest data from IPEDS, U.S. Department of Education for academic year 2022-2023. The following table compares the student population for both undergraduate and graduate schools between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Southeastern Baptist Theological Seminary has the most enrolled students of 2,764, while Jung Tao School of Classical Chinese Medicine has the least number of students of 83 for both in graduate and undergraduate programs.

Undergraduate Student Population

The total undergraduate population of selected colleges is 2,876 with 1,462 female students and 1,414 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 undergradu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Mars Hill University has the most enrolled undergraduate students of 994, while Salem College has the least number of undergraduate students of 364.

Graduate Student Population

The total graduate population of selected colleges is 2,311 with 727 female students and 1,584 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 gradu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Southeastern Baptist Theological Seminary has the most enrolled graduate students of 2,085, while Mars Hill University has the least number of graduate students of 38.
